What I initially thought was just a feel good Democrat bill, has turned out to co-sponsored by a number of [b]Republicans[/b].

An Act to amend 938.78 (3) and 946.82 (4); and to create 941.2985 of the statutes; relating to: firearm flash suppressors and providing a penalty. (FE)
2001

10-15-01.       A.       Introduced by Representatives Staskunas, Ladwig, Jeskewitz, Bies, Ryba, Colon, La Fave, Boyle, Kreuser, Stone and Ott; cosponsored by Senators Burke, Roessler, Rosenzweig and Huelsman.
View Quote


This would [b]BAN[/b] flash suppressors in Wisconsin, though I don't know if previously owned FS's would be grandfathered in.
